Choosing key position/level
Key position 0 - Unlock the car - This
means that the car's electrical system is
at level 0.
Key position I - With the remote control
key fully inserted into the ignition switch
- Briefly press START/STOP ENGINE.
NOTE
To reach level I or II without starting the
engine - do not depress the brake/clutch
pedal when these key positions are due to
be selected.
Key position II - With the remote control
key fully inserted into the ignition switch
- Give a long
16
press on START/STOP
ENGINE.
Back to key position 0 - To return to key
position 0 from position II and I - Briefly
press on START/STOP ENGINE.
